  7. Check your crossover. RF7s are full range and you could put them to large If your receiver has an LFE/Bass setting...set it to "Both" or "LFE + Mains" or whatever the setting is to send the bass to both the mains and the sub. You should look into to getting an emotiva xpa2(probably can score a used one for about $500) or you can check out a used Outlaw amp.
